Reality Capture Specialist Manager at DLR Group

DLR Group is an integrated design firm with a promise to elevate the human experience through design. This fuels the work we do around the world and inspires our mission to improve the lives of our clients, our communities, and our planet. If this sparks your interest, you’re in the right place.

Our Reality Capture team has an opening for a Reality Capture Specialist Manager in our Los Angeles studio.

About Reality Capture at DLR Group

The Reality Capture team utilizes a combination of lidar 3D scans, photogrammetry, photographs, and construction documents to create 3D models that elevate accuracy and safety throughout the lifecycle of our projects.

Position Summary

As a Reality Capture Specialist Manager at DLR Group you will use advanced technology to quickly develop digital models of existing buildings and spaces. Attention to detail is critical, as the resulting deliverables will be used by DLR Group design teams and clients. You will have a passion for cutting-edge technology and the ability to apply it effectively to varying project scopes.

Architectural knowledge of existing buildings is crucial.

You will partner directly with the Project Manager to ensure the financial health of the project, the quality of project documents, claim prevention, team collaboration, and communication. Additionally, you will lead the cross-functional design disciplines in developing technical solutions.

What you will do

Lead and mentor Reality Capture Specialists in your region, ensuring technical growth and project success

Communicate effectively with the Reality Capture Team to align priorities and workflows

Train staff on advanced scanning techniques and accurate building capture documentation

Operate, register, and process data from a wide range of 3D laser scanning equipment

Apply expert technical skills to evaluate building conditions and deliver precise, efficient 3D scans

Conduct regular QA checks of scanning work to maintain compliance with client and DLR Group standards

Participate in BIM kickoff meetings and contribute lessons learned in team meetings and training sessions

Manage project schedules and budgets to ensure scanning projects are delivered on time and within scope

Required qualifications

Bachelor of Architecture (B. Arch), Engineering, or Survey degree; actively working toward licensure

10-12 years of professional 3D scanning experience, inclusive of at least 5 years of project management experience

Remote Pilot Certificate (FAA Part 107 UAS Pilot License)

Proficiency in Autodesk Revit, AutoCAD, Civil3D, InfraWorks, Recap, Navisworks, BIM360/ACC, and Dynamo

Experience with Point Cloud software such as Leica Cyclone/Register360, Field360, 3DR, and CloudWorx

Strong understanding of building documentation best practices

Knowledge of Level of Accuracy (LOA) standards for 3D Capture and Level of Detail (LOD) standards for BIM

Proven ability to manage and collaborate across multiple project teams concurrently

Preferred qualifications

CSI, USIBD, and Autodesk certifications (or actively working toward certification)

Experience with additional software tools such as NavVis, Leica, Esri, and Cintoo

Understanding of how to integrate emerging technologies into sustainable and environmentally responsible building design and construction
